Sherline headstocks and parts been available in a range of designs from the factory. Normally ER16 and MT1. Both of which are really small. Sherline also uses WW collet sets for extremely small work. Generally watchmakers and clockmakers use the WW collets. Many prefer ER25, ER32 or even ER40 collet sizes with a bigger spindle travel through hole. The 5C collet for the Sherline lathe would be the very best. For Sherline mills, many truly do not care for the MT1 and hardly like the ER16. An R8 spindle with a low profile would be best. Sherline provides many parts and attachments, but not much to make it a much better machine. To begin with, they headstock uses poor quality bearings and the bearings are too small. This means the spindle itself requires to be small. A spindle with extremely little mass suggests the lathe or mill the surface quality will not be as good and based on vibration issues. For example, they use numerous lathe accessories, however you can’t get a 5C headstock or ER25, ER32 or ER40. Plus, the go through hole needs to be little because the bearings are small. There is a similar issue with the mill. You can just use ER16 collets and this limits its use. Of course those in Vero Beach, Florida 32967 may have different needs.
